Rotax® 914UL DCDI

 

4 cylinder, 4 stroke liquid/air cooled engine with opposed cylinders, with turbo charger, automatic waste gate control, dry sump forced lubrication with seperate 3l (.8 gal US) oil tank, automatic adjustment by hydraulic valve tappet, 2 CD carburetors, electronic dual ignition, electric starter, integrated reduction gear i= 2.243, engine truss assembly, air intake system, exhaust system.

Options

914 UL3

Suitable for 'Constatnt Speed' propellers.
Includes:
drive for hydraulic variable speed governor
Woodward variable speed governor (part# 886 730)
Slipper clutch for reduction gearbox.

914 UL4

Suitable for 'fixed pitch' propellers
Same as Rotax 914 UL2 but fitted with propeller shaft that would allow the engine to be converted to a 914 UL3 for use with a constant speed propeller.
